1. A modular valve island comprising:
a plurality of valves;
a plurality of sub-bases, wherein each one of the plurality of valves is associated with a corresponding one of the plurality of sub-bases;
a supply exhaust module;
a data communication module; and
a diagnostic module,
wherein at least one of the plurality of valves has at least one integrated sensor, wherein the at least one integrated sensor is configured to detect an operating condition of the modular valve island, wherein the at least one integrated sensor is electrically connected to the diagnostic module to send sensor signals thereto,
wherein the diagnostic module is configured to receive and process the sensor signals therein to identify the operating condition, and
wherein the modular valve island is configured to provide data relating to the operating condition of the modular valve island via at least one of:
(i) a user interface provided in the diagnostic module,
(ii) an industrial Ethernet link, or
(iii) a wireless network and/or cloud communication link,
wherein the at least one integrated sensor is provided on a sensor unit, the sensor unit located between the plurality of valves and the plurality of sub-bases,
wherein the sensor unit comprises:
a housing adapted to be electrically connected between a valve and a sub-base of the modular valve island, the sensor unit defining a plurality of passages between the valve and the sub-base of the modular valve island to allow fluid flow therebetween, the sensor unit including the at least one integrated sensor, wherein the at least one integrated sensor comprises a pressure sensor, and wherein the pressure sensor is fluidly connected to a passage of the plurality of passages of the sensor unit, and wherein the sensor unit further comprises (i) a sensing chamber via which the pressure sensor senses pressure level, and (ii) a gasket that defines, at least in part, a fluid connection between the passage and the sensing chamber.
